The Importance of PUP Joint Tubing in Oil and Gas Operations


In the oil and gas industry, the efficiency and reliability of drilling operations are paramount. One key component that contributes to the success of these operations is the PUP joint tubing. While it may seem like a small part of the larger drilling assembly, PUP joints play a crucial role in the overall performance and safety of drilling activities.


PUP joint tubing, short for performance pup joint, is a length of pipe that connects different sections of the drill string, especially in applications where the standard drill pipe length may not suffice. These pipes are typically shorter than regular drill pipes and are used to make fine adjustments to the drill string length. Their primary purpose is to facilitate the drilling process by providing the necessary flexibility and adaptability in drilling depths and angles.


One of the most significant advantages of PUP joints is their ability to accommodate variations in drilling requirements. In many drilling operations, the geographical and geological conditions can change dramatically over short distances. For instance, drilling through soft formations may require a different approach than drilling through hard rock. PUP joints allow operators to modify the length of the drill string to suit these changing conditions, enhancing the overall efficiency of the operation.


Moreover, PUP joint tubing contributes to the safety of drilling operations. Inadequate adjustments to the drill string can result in excess stress on the equipment, leading to potential failures or accidents. By incorporating PUP joints, operators can effectively manage the stress and tension within the drill string, reducing the risk of equipment failure and enhancing safety for the crew.

In addition to their practicality, PUP joint tubing is typically made from high-quality materials like steel, allowing them to withstand the harsh conditions encountered during drilling. These joints are designed to endure high pressures and temperatures, ensuring they remain functional even in challenging environments. This durability is essential, as the failure of any part of the drill string can lead to costly delays and losses.


The deployment of PUP joints also aids in the drilling performance optimization. By using shorter sections of tubing, operators can improve the overall control of the drilling process. This precision is vital for ensuring that the drill bit remains on the desired path, which is crucial for reaching targeted geological formations efficiently.


Furthermore, PUP joint tubing can be critical in reducing non-productive time (NPT), which is a common issue in drilling operations. NPT refers to the periods when drilling operations are halted due to unforeseen reasons, such as equipment failure or slow drilling progress. By utilizing PUP joints, drilling crews can quickly adapt to varying conditions, reducing the likelihood of downtime and improving project timelines.
